MillerCoors took a significant step toward environmental responsibility and operational efficiency by implementing a complete LED lighting upgrade at their 400,000-square-foot distribution center. This project not only enhanced visibility and safety but also yielded substantial energy savings and a rapid return on investment.
Location: MillerCoors Distribution Center
Project Size: 400,000 Sq. Ft.
Upgrade: Complete LED Lighting Replacement
Fixtures Upgraded: 1,779
The primary objective was to improve lighting quality and reduce energy consumption while achieving a strong return on investment. By securing a utility rebate to offset project costs, MillerCoors could make a financially viable and sustainable upgrade with minimal upfront expense.
1. Significant Energy Savings
The LED lighting upgrade led to a 51.4% reduction in electricity consumption, allowing MillerCoors to cut costs substantially. This change reflects a significant commitment to energy efficiency and a move toward greener operations.
2. Impressive Return on Investment
The project yielded a 465% return on investment with an expected payback period of just 2 years. The savings achieved quickly covered the installation costs, underscoring the financial benefits of energy-efficient solutions.
3. Carbon Emissions Reduction
By reducing energy consumption, MillerCoors is helping the environment. The project’s impact is equivalent to a reduction of 8,052 metric tons of CO₂ emissions—a powerful move toward sustainability and environmental stewardship.
4. Secured Utility Rebate
Through careful planning and collaboration, MillerCoors secured a utility rebate of over $200,000, significantly offsetting initial expenses and allowing the project to proceed without financial strain.
